When PBO is in water exposed to sunlight, it is quickly broken down and has a half-lifeof 8.4 hours. It is also very short-lived in the air, with a half-life of 3.4 hours. Sunlight and soil microbes can break down PBO. In shallow soil exposed to sunlight, half-lives ranged from 1-3 days. WebbPiperonyl butoxide (PBO) is a pale yellow to light brown liquid organic compound used as a synergist component of pesticide formulations. That is, despite having no pesticidal activity of its own, it enhances the potency of certain pesticides such as carbamates, pyrethrins, pyrethroids, and rotenone.
